SIR MURCHISON FLETCHER, C.M.G., C.8.E., the new Governor of Fiji and High Commissioner of the Western Pacific, photographed with Lady Fletcher aboard the Aorangi this morning. Sir Murchison is of the opinion that New Zealand should foster trade with the East. For the past three years he has been Colonial Secretary of Ceylon.
